I just received a couple of remotes for rca tv's, from ebay. They are for the ctc74/81 DIRECT ADDRESS models, that Rca made, from
1976-1978. I am seking one of these tv's- They have NO power, volume, or channel controls on them, all of this was done by remote. now that I have the remotes, I would like one of the tv's.

They were made in console models-(the ctc81ad), and portable models-(the ctc74ad).I would rather have the portable, due to space reasons. If anyone has one, that they would be willing to part with, and is within a reasonable distance from me, let me know.

NOTE: I am NOT seeking an ordinary ctc-74 or 81. ONLY the direct address models, (these have no controls on the front,or behind a door, and are easy to recognize.

The Heathkit GR-2000 and later series of sets had OSD of both channel and time.....remote control was optional. They also had pushbutton tuning and volume. Until Zenith bought them and substituted kit versions of regular Zenith sets they (original Heath sets) used RCA picture tubes.

I had a RCA CTC-92 with OSD (channel and time) from around 1979...it was a delta gun CRT (set had really bad crt so was salvaged for parts).
Also the Magnavox Star System had OSD...around 1975. I know their 19" sets were inlines at that time but the 25" consoles may have been delta.
